Not residue on the lens, it is lens flare.

Look at the ceiling fan and lighting fixture.

The 3 'hot spots' on the gold fixture and the glass on the light exactly match up with the three orbs your photo is showing. Either the flash from the camera, or another light source is reflecting off of the ceiling fan/fixture and hitting the lens of the camera capturing these 'orbs.'

Yup , it is dust. To test this take a flash photo of your sofa. Now pat sofa hard a few times , and take another picture. The second picture will have many more orbs in it.
